What is Chris Isaak's Biography?
To understand the context of Chris Isaak's illness, it's essential to first appreciate his background and career. Born on June 26, 1956, in Stockton, California, Chris Isaak grew up in a family of musicians, which undoubtedly influenced his passion for music. He began his career in the late 1980s and quickly became known for his unique blend of rock and country music. With hit songs like "Wicked Game" and "Baby Did a Bad Bad Thing," Isaak has garnered a loyal fan base and critical acclaim.
